Son of JJ's daughter-in-law Helen (née Kastor) by her first marriage to publisher Leon Samuel Fleischman. David Fleischman was born in New York and was educated at Phillips Academy, Andover, Massachusetts from 1934 before studying for a year at Harvard (1940-1), specialising in Literature and History and active in student politics. In 1942 he married Dorothy Rachel Myers, moved to Newton, Massachusetts, and enlisted in the US Army, serving as a Staff Sergeant in France. He subsequently trained as an accountant in Newton and continued there as a CPA until his death in 1967, aged forty-eight. John Simpson
